原文:仿照jquery封装一个自己的js库(一)

所谓造轮子的好处就是复习知识点,加深对原版jquery的理解。 本文系笔者学习jquery的笔记,记述一个名为 dQuery 的初级版和缩水版jquery库的实现。主要涉及知识点包括面向对象,jquery,绑定,脚本化css等。 一. jquery的美元符意味什么 先思考alert typeof 的结果中的 ,它是一个对象,也是一个函数。 所以美元符字面上是jQuery,其实就是一个jq对象,里面 ...

2016-10-31 07:44 0 4556 推荐指数:

查看详情

仿照jquery封装一个自己的js(二)

本篇为完结篇。主要讲述如何造出轮子的高级特性。 一. css方法的高级操作 先看本文第一部分所讲的dQuery css方法 在这个方法里,只能一次一行,且只能设置一个属性。效率还不够高。现在尝试通过设置类似$d('#div1').css({width:'200px',height ...

Tue Nov 01 10:38:00 CST 2016 0 1990
如何简单的封装一个js

1、 (function() { window.sbDog= {}; //创建一个自己的对象相当于C#中的命名空间 var getId = function(id) { return ...

Fri Jul 27 18:25:00 CST 2018 0 1466
仿(用原生js封装jQuery——$、选择器)

function JQuery(arg){   //存对象   this.elements=[];   switch(typeof arg){     case 'string':       this.elements=getEle(arg);       this.length ...

Fri May 26 18:29:00 CST 2017 0 2052
原生js实现jquery中选择器的功能(jquery封装一)

今天是2017.1.1,新的一天,新的一年,新的一年里继续夯实基础知识,在工作中多些项目,多思考,多总结,前端是不断更新,在更新的过程中也是发现乐趣和挑战自我的过程,希望年轻的我和年轻的javascript在2017年中一同成长 今天又一次封装一个jquery使用方法相同的,每次写 ...

Mon Jan 02 03:41:00 CST 2017 0 5378
js封装一个websocket

原文:https://www.jianshu.com/p/938004c22ed9 创建websocket.js let Socket = '' let setIntervalWesocketPush = null ...

Wed Nov 18 23:29:00 CST 2020 0 1423
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M